Hi, i´m trying to share a rclone mount in my TrueNAS SCALE 20.02.3 and i don't know which's the best method to make it.

I already mounted my google drive share on /mnt/cloud/ with this service on github and it's running fine, i can do "cd /mnt/cloud/... and i can see the folders and files on my shared drive on google.

Now i dont know hot to share by smb or nfs because TrueNAS said me that is not a ZFS filesystem.

You can't share the Google drive... you can copy it to a zfs dataset that can be shared.
